  • What advice would you give a customer looking to hire a provider in your area of work?

    Always try to provide as much information as possible. It is hard to give an accurate quote when the only information we have is "I know what I want" without any inkling as to what that is. The more informative you are, the better we can do our jobs, and the more accurate our quotes will be.
